WRISE’s What the Buzz? – Beyond MWhs – Honey Bees, Climate Justice and Emissionality

March 1, 2022 @ 2:00 pm - 3:00 pm

The race towards Net-Zero or Carbon Neutrality by 2050 is underway. Many corporations are now seeking to connect and integrate specific United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) into their energy procurement decisions. They are rethinking what makes a project the “best” project to account for avoided emissions, social & environment justice, supply chain sourcing, and local impact. Additionally, most off-takers to date have tackled scope 2 emissions (purchased electricity and heat) via PPAs/ VPPAs. Yet scope 3 emissions (generated by suppliers and customers) constitute the largest source of corporate’s emissions, which will be their next challenge to tackle.
